Some shots of the Sony Magnetic Charging Speaker BSC10
http://www.xperiaguide.com/20[....]ing-pad-bsc10-hands-on-photos/

It has a spekaer on the front and two on the sides



It has a blue led for notification and incoming calls
and obviously a magnetic dock for charging... there's NFC to pair the devices and Bluetooth


on his back there's an AC input for electricity and also a 3,5 jack IN for external audio!


In the pics it seems to be working with Xperia Z2, Tablet Z2 and Xperia Z1... on the Sony sites it says it works with every Xperia Device with a magnetic connector!
